LMDZ.MARS
+ MESOSCALE
- An important change to merge physiq.F and inifis.F for GCM and mesoscale
- This is mostly transparent to GCM users and developers (use of MESOSCALE precompiler flags)
- Makes it easy (and mostly automatic!) for changes in GCM physics to be impacted in mesoscale physics
- A few minor changes have followed in the GCM (slope scheme, one-point diagnostic).
- Compilation + run is OK on both sides (GCM and mesoscale).
- On the mesoscale side, call_meso_physiq?.inc and call_meso_inifis?.inc have been changed accordingly.
Here is the excerpt from README file:
19/07/2011 == AS
- Finished converging meso_physiq.F and meso_inifis.F towards physiq.F and inifis.F
--> see previous point 15/07/2011
--> meso_ routines no longer exist (everything is in meso_inc and transparent to GCM users)
--> GCM routines include mesoscale parts within MESOSCALE precompiler commands
--> MESOSCALE parts are as hidden as possible not to mess up with GCM users/developers
- Cleaned inelegant or useless #ifdef [or] #ifndef MESOSCALE in physiq and inifis so that
a minimum amount of such precompiler commands is now reached [mainly related to I/O]
- Added the SF08 slope insolation model in the general physics parameterizations.
Added a callslope keyword in inifis.F and callkeys.h
--> This keyword is False by default / True if you use -DMESOSCALE
- Removed the obsolete call to Viking Lander 1 diagnostic
Replaced it with a diagnostic for opacity at the domain center [valid for GCM and mesoscale]
